The most famous building by Frank is the Guggenheim Museum, Bilbao, Spain, described by Time Magazine as "The Building of the Century". More recently he completed the Walt Disney Concert Hall in LA.

Frank Gehry (1929-) was born in Toronto, Canada and has become a naturalised American citizen.

He was won the most prestigious architecture awards incl. Pritzker Architecture Prize (1989) American Institute of Architects Gold Medal (1999) and the Royal Institute of British Architects Gold Medal (2000).

Frank Gehry's reinterpretation of a Scottish Broch: signature architecture of shiny surfaces on 'vernacular' base. Frank Gehry was selected to design Dundee Maggies Centre by friend Charles Jencks and his late wife, Maggie Keswick-Jencks - who died of cancer and set about creating civilised buildings for people learning to cope with cancer.

Frank Gehry : The Architect

Frank Gehry is Design Principal for the firm of Gehry Partners. Before founding the practice, Frank Gehry worked with architects Victor Gruen and Pereira & Luckman in Los Angeles, USA, and with André Remondet in Paris, France.

Raised in Toronto, Canada, Frank Gehry moved with his family to Los Angeles in 1947. Gehry received his Bachelor of Architecture degree from the University of Southern California in 1954, and he studied City Planning at the Harvard University Graduate School of Design.

As well as architecture, Frank Gehry has made many designs for cardboard & bentwood furniture.

Frank Gehry - Awards

Pritzker Architecture Prize 1989
Arnold W. Brunner Memorial Prize in Architecture 1977
Wolf Prize in Art (Architecture) 1992
Praemium Imperiale Award 1992
Gold Medal - American Institute of Architects 1999
Gold Medal - Royal Institute of British Architects 2000
Lifetime Achievement Award - Americans for the Arts 2000
